Joel Murphy and Lars Periwinkle remember two icons who passed away recently – Harry Dean Stanton and Bobby “The Brain” Heenan. Both were legends in their industries who will be missed. They dynamic duo share their thoughts on both tremendous careers.
They also talk about Red Sparrow, which seems to have quite a few similarities to Black Widow, and Lars tells you why you should know Kyle Cooper.
Does pizza have carbs? What is Bobby Heenan’s favorite song? Is Kyle Cooper okay? The answers to these questions and more are on this week’s show.
